Original Description
Step into the lively world of Rue De Paris Animee by Théophile Alexandre Steinlen, where Parisian street life pulses with democratic energy. Painted circa late 19th century during Belle Époque, Steinlen captures ordinary Parisians—flower vendors, workers, and gossiping women—with swift, expressive lithographic strokes, reflecting his background in popular illustration and satirical journals like Le Chat Noir. His work bridges Impressionist spontaneity and Social Realist grit, portraying unvarnished urban vitality while critiquing class divides. As a contemporary of Toulouse-Lautrec, Steinlen’s scenes of Montmartre hold historical significance, documenting Paris’s transformation into a modern metropolis through an accessible yet subversive lens that influenced later Expressionist street narratives.
